Evaluate f(-3) for f(x) = 2^x<br> a. 1/8<br> b. -8<br> c. 8<br> d. -6
pickupchik [31]

Answer:

A

Step-by-step explanation:

f(-3) = 2^-3

to get rid of a negative in an exponent, move the whole thing to the denominator.

1/(2^3)

2^3 = 2×2×2

1/(2×2×2)

1/8
